Rocscience Slide3 v3.0 Overview
Rocscience Slide3 v3.0 is a powerful 3D limit equilibrium slope stability analysis software, built to handle complex geotechnical challenges in civil and mining engineering. It extends the capabilities of Rocscience’s Slide2 software into full 3D, enabling engineers to model advanced geometries like landslides, mechanically stabilized earth (MSE) walls, open-pit mines, and slopes with soil nails or other supports. The software calculates the factor of safety for 3D failure surfaces without requiring users to predefined sliding directions, making it highly efficient for complex models.
Key Features

3D Modeling and Analysis:

Supports modeling of complex geometries, including landslides, dams, embankments, retaining walls, and open-pit mines.
Imports 3D surfaces from formats like .dxf, .dwg, .obj, .stl, .step, .iges, .tin, .asc, .xyz, or block models from software like Leapfrog, Deswik, Datamine, and Vulcan.
Allows creation of geometry from borehole data, point clouds, or CAD tools within Slide3.
Features tools like Terrain Generator for importing satellite map textures and Multi-section Creator for generating 2D Slide2 sections within a 3D model.

Advanced Search Methods:

Uses global metaheuristic search methods (e.g., Cuckoo Search, Particle Swarm) and local Surface Altering Technology to locate critical failure surfaces.
Spline Search Method for capturing complex failure mechanisms with high accuracy.
Parallel processing accelerates analysis, delivering results over 10x faster than competitors.

Material and Support Models:

Comprehensive material library with models like Mohr-Coulomb, Generalized Hoek-Brown, Barton-Bandis, Anisotropic, and SHANSEP for soil and rock.
Supports various types, including end-anchored bolts, grouted tiebacks, soil nails, micropiles, and geotextiles, with flexible orientation options.

Groundwater and Loading:

Handles pore pressure with water surfaces, Ru coefficients, or water pressure grids imported from RS3 or other sources.
Supports point loads, distributed loads, seismic loads, and rapid drawdown conditions for dams.

Integrations:

Seamless integration with Slide2 for exporting 2D sections, RS3 for finite-element analysis, and RSPile for pile support modeling.
Allows direct import of RS3 models and export of 2D sections to Slide2 or RS2 for combined analysis.

New Features in v3.0:

Block Model Projection: Visualizes block models on external surfaces for detailed geological analysis and 2D section creation.
Sensitivity Analysis: Evaluates how changes in material properties, loads, or seismic inputs affect stability results.
Intelligent Search: Enhances slip surface identification with search clusters and detailed safety maps.
Note: As of version 3.011, Slide3 uses a new SQL database format, breaking forward compatibility with older versions. Users must update to the latest version to read these files.
